Turns out director Judd Apatow was shooting "Knocked Up," his follow-up to the 40-Year-Virgin. Because Heigl's character plays a red carpet reporter, they decided to shoot impromptu interviews at the MTV Movie Awards.

I have to share... Despite what tabloids say, I found Ms. Lohan to be an absolute doll. Upon introducing myself (as a fellow Lindzi) to Lindsay, she asked how I spelled my name. When I told her about the "Zi" spelling, she remarked, "Really? I've been thinking of changing my name. My mom gave me permission." From there, we bantered about my Isabella Fiore "Summer Love" bag (which she loved!), the Devendra Banhart q&a she compiled for Interview Magazine (which I told her I loved!)... and then our actual interview began!

Before parting ways, I teased, "If I see you spelling your name with a Zi, I'll know where it came from." She laughed and continued to chat more about Devendra. She even recommended a few of his songs to me. Although the conversation wasn't ready for a natural conclusion, my time was clearly up as they hearded the next journalist into the room. Ah, well!
